Friends of Scottie Hammond are hosting a benefit on Sunday 11/16/08 at Harley-Davidson of Baton Rouge from 8 a.m. to 5 p.m. Scottie is a 38 year old Baton Rouge Police Dept. motorman with a wife and two children - who has been fighting cancer since February of 2007. Morning features a "BlackJack Run" from Harley-Davidson of Baton Rouge to Hammond Harley-Davidson and back. $10 per hand, 3rd card for $5. Hit "BlackJack" with two cards and win $20. Hit "21" with 3 cards, win $10. If you're from the Hammond area, you can register and start at the Hammond HD. Afternoon features plate lunches by the Jambalaya Festival winner, live music by "Ambiance," a live auction for a MC Lo-Jack and other items, lots and lots of door prizes, and CAWS will be doing their pet photos with Santa upstairs. Raffle tickets being sold for Dec. 5 drawing for (1st prize) ATK 450 High-Performance ATV and (2nd prize) Remington 870 shotgun.
